Open Access Policy

Journal of Informatics and Computational Applications (JICA) is an open-access journal, which means that all content is freely available to users without charge. Users are allowed to read, download, copy, distribute, print, search, or link to the full texts of the articles, or use them for any other lawful purpose, without asking prior permission from the publisher or the author, provided the original work is properly cited.

This policy is in accordance with the Budapest Open Access Initiative (BOAI) definition of open access.

Licensing

All articles published in JICA are licensed under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 International (CC BY 4.0) license. Under this license, authors retain copyright, and others are allowed to share, reuse, remix, or adapt the work for any purpose—even commercially—as long as proper attribution is given to the original authors.

Author Rights

  • Authors retain full copyright.

  • Authors can archive the submitted version, accepted version, and published version of their article in any repository or website without embargo.

  • Authors may reuse the content in future works with acknowledgment of its original publication in JICA.
